EP155: Fan Membership Sites: Avoiding Overload

A membership site is a powerful way for artists to engage with their fans and build recurring revenue in their business. However, the process of actually building a membership can be so overwhelming that many musicians skip over it altogether!

So to clear the path, in this episode, Corrin and Jack break down some of the biggest blockers in the way of Indies that want to build a membership site for their fans. From Patreon to custom built sites, get clarity on what platforms work best based on your fanbase and what to do when you're ready to grow.

Building a membership site is an excellent way to make your fans feel like they're part of something exclusive. So, whether you're just starting to plan a membership site or looking to make yours even better, this episode is for you!

DISCOVER:

  • How to avoid perfection analysis paralysis
  • Where Patreon takes The W for memberships
  • What you should consider in your tech stack
  • How to plan a minimum viable product membership site
  • How to survey your fans to build your tiers
  • When to consider a customer membership site build
